2025526· A Vertical Shaft Impact Crusher, commonly known as a VSI crusher, is a specialized machine used in the production of fine aggregates and sand. Unlike traditional compression-based crushers, VSI crushers utilize high-speed rotors and impact mechanisms to break materials down into smaller, precisely shaped particles. WORKING PRINCIPLE The materials are crushed via impact energy produced in the impact crusher. When the materials enter the zone of the board hammer, they are flung into the impact equipments via the high-speed impact of the board hammer. These materials will be re-crushed after rebounding into the scale board.
